ソースを参照

fix: remove-params

コミット
394a8ab644
共有3 個のファイルを変更した3 個の追加3 個の削除を含む
  1. 1
    1
      resources/js/components/AppDateRangeFilter.vue
  2. 1
    1
      resources/js/components/AppDropdownFilter.vue
  3. 1
    1
      resources/js/components/AppSearchFilter.vue

+ 1
- 1
resources/js/components/AppDateRangeFilter.vue ファイルの表示

46
     var end_date = null
46
     var end_date = null
47
   }
47
   }
48
 
48
 
49
-  removeParams('start_date', 'end_date')
49
+  removeParams('start_date', 'end_date', 'page')
50
 
50
 
51
   Inertia.reload({
51
   Inertia.reload({
52
     data: pickBy({
52
     data: pickBy({

+ 1
- 1
resources/js/components/AppDropdownFilter.vue ファイルの表示

22
 const status = ref()
22
 const status = ref()
23
 
23
 
24
 watch(status, (status) => {
24
 watch(status, (status) => {
25
-  removeParams('status')
25
+  removeParams('status', 'page')
26
 
26
 
27
   Inertia.reload({
27
   Inertia.reload({
28
     data: pickBy({
28
     data: pickBy({

+ 1
- 1
resources/js/components/AppSearchFilter.vue ファイルの表示

20
 const search = ref(props.initialSearch)
20
 const search = ref(props.initialSearch)
21
 
21
 
22
 watch(search, (search) => {
22
 watch(search, (search) => {
23
-  removeParams('search')
23
+  removeParams('search', 'page')
24
 
24
 
25
   Inertia.reload({
25
   Inertia.reload({
26
     data: pickBy({ search }),
26
     data: pickBy({ search }),